首页 > 解决方案 > 创建 Microsoft Flow 自定义连接器失败并显示“上传文件失败”

问题描述

我正在尝试从 OpenAPI 文件创建 Microsoft Flow 自定义连接器,如此处所述

它允许我导入文件,并在 UI 中正确显示操作。但是,当我单击“创建连接器”时,它会失败并显示消息“无法上传大小为 7952 和 sasUrl https://... 的文件 XXX”。

当我查看浏览器网络日志时,我看到它正在向以下位置发出 OPTIONS 请求: https ://pafeblobprodln.blob.core.windows.net/20180510t000000z97e13b316929479b8f4f2ae6ab7856ba/sage-200-flow-connectorswagger.json?sv=2017-04- 17&sr=c&si=SASpolicy&sig=XXX=&comp=block&blockid=XXX=

哪些因“未启用 403 CORS 或未找到此请求的匹配规则”而失败。请求“Origin”标头设置为https://unitedkingdom.flow.microsoft.com

看起来 Blob 容器上没有启用 CORS,至少对于 unitedkingdom.flow.microsoft.com 而言。

使用相同的 OpenAPI 文件,我可以成功创建逻辑应用自定义连接器,而不是自定义连接器。

有没有其他人遇到过并解决过这个问题?

谢谢

皮特

标签: power-automate

解决方案


我发现了同样的问题。我确实设法通过 web.powerapps.com 在 powerapps 中创建自定义连接器来使其工作,然后可以在 Flow 中使用它。希望有帮助。

我还发现无法在 UK Flow 中创建审批连接器。至少在默认环境下你不能。如果你创造一个新的环境,他们可以工作。


推荐阅读